Subject: Tailspin CLI key rotation

Heads-up for the weekly sync: the Tailspin log-tailing CLI rotates its service key Friday. Old key stops working at noon. Update your local config before then; the CLI will prompt if auth fails. No changes to flags or output format. Questions go to the Pipeworks channel. For reference during the transition window, the new key is below.

service key, yadug-bajog: zpat3_pou

Retail Pilot — Orvano Stores (Managers Only)

The six-week pilot of our Fernlight shelf-analytics units across four Orvano Stores locations in the Kestwick region begins next month. Hardware installation is complete; staff training runs this week under Priya Aldenmoor. Heads of department should hold all external communication until results are reviewed. Commercial implications are summarised in the confidential note that follows.

confidential, fahip-bagep: The southern region missed its Holwyn quota by 21.5 percent last quarter. Sorvanek Foods plans to raise the Jorir list price by 23.9 percent in December. The pricing group signed off on a budget of $411.6 million for Project Eliion. The renewal with Juldorix Works closes at $87.9 million a year, 16.8 percent below the last contract.

Handover — Loading Dock Hours (Marlow Wharf site)

Priya, a reminder for reception: the dock now accepts deliveries 07:00–15:30 only, per the new Cartwell Logistics contract. Anything arriving later must be redirected to next morning — no exceptions, the shutter alarms after hours. Couriers needing signatures should buzz the dock office first. If staff must open the dock side door themselves, they should use the pass code below.

turnstile pass: bdg-QZV-3